Brownie

Ingredients

For the Brownie Cookies

  • 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up chocolate chips (optional)

For the Cookie Dough Filling

  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up chocolate chips

How to Make Brownie Cookie Dough Sandwich Cookies: An Amazing Ultimate 7-Layer Dessert Delight

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line your baking sheets with parchment paper.

Step 2: Prepare Brownie Batter

In a large bowl, whisk together:
– Cocoa powder
– Flour
– Baking powder
– Salt

In another bowl, beat together:
– Melted butter
– Eggs
– Vanilla extract
– Granulated sugar until well combined.

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

Gradually mix the dry ingredients from the first bowl into the wet ingredients. Stir in chocolate chips if desired.

Step 4: Scoop Cookies

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, drop rounded spoonfuls of brownie batter onto the prepared baking sheets. Space them about 2 inches apart.

Step 5: Bake

Bake in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es or until edges are set but centers are still slightly soft. Allow them to cool on the baking sheets for 10 minutes before transferring to wire racks to cool completely.

Step 6: Make Cookie Dough Filling

In a separate bowl, cream together:
– Softened butter with both sugars until fluffy.
– Mix in vanilla extract.
Gradually add flour and salt, mixing until fully incorporated. Stir in chocolate chips.

Step 7: Assemble Cookies

Once brownies are completely cool, take one brownie cookie and spread a generous layer of cookie dough filling on the flat side. Top with another brownie cookie to form a sandwich.

Step 8: Repeat

Continue assembling until all brownie cookies are filled.

Step 9: Chill (optional)

For a firmer filling, refrigerate the assembled sandwich cookies for about 30 minutes.

Step 10: Serve and Enjoy

These decadent cookies are ready to be enjoyed!

How to Perfect Brownie Cookie Dough Sandwich Cookies: An Amazing Ultimate 7-Layer Dessert Delight

To achieve the best results when making these delicious cookies, consider these helpful tips.

  •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Make sure your butter and eggs are at room temperature for better mixing and smoother batter.

  • Don’t Overmix the Batter: Mix just until combined to keep your brownie cookies soft and chewy. Overmixing can lead to tougher cookies.

  • Chill Your Dough: If time allows, chill the brownie batter for about 30 minutes before baking. This helps prevent spreading and creates thicker cookies.

  • Check Baking Time: Keep an eye on your cookies while baking. They should be set at the edges but still slightly soft in the center for optimal texture.

  • Store Properly: Store any le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ature or refrigerate them for longer freshness.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making Brownie Cookie Dough Sandwich Cookies: An Amazing Ultimate 7-Layer Dessert Delight can be a fun and rewarding experience. However, there are common mistakes that can affect the outcome of your delicious creation.

  • Not Measuring Ingredients Accurately: Precision is key in baking. Use measuring cups and spoons to ensure you add the right amounts of cocoa powder, flour, and sugar.
  • Overmixing the Batter: Mixing too much can result in tough cookies. Mix just until combined for a soft and chewy texture.
  • Skipping the Cooling Time: Allow brownies to cool completely before assembling. If they’re warm, the cookie dough filling may melt and create a mess.
  • Using Cold Ingredients: Ensure that your butter is softened before using it for both the brownie batter and cookie dough filling. Cold butter won’t mix well, affecting texture.
  • Ignoring Oven Temperature: Keep an eye on your oven temperature; even slight variations can lead to undercooked or overcooked cookies.
